The Difference Between Fleeting Luxury and Lasting Luxury

Trends vs. Design Principles

Trends are, by definition, temporary. A fashionable finish today feels dated within five years. In contrast, timeless design principles — golden proportions, natural light, noble materials, neutral palettes — have worked for centuries.

At One Laguna, every residence was designed under these principles. You won't find eye-catching colors that tire the eye or whimsical shapes that lose meaning over time. Instead, you'll find noble materials that age with dignity: natural stone that develops patina, tropical hardwoods that gain character, and brass that oxidizes with elegance.

Natural Light as a Design Material

Strategic Solar Orientation

Each tower at One Laguna was oriented to capture Caribbean light optimally. In the morning, soft golden light enters from the east. At sunset, spaces are bathed in amber tones that reflect off the Nichupté Lagoon. This relationship with light changes every hour, every season — but always enriches the space.

Floor-to-Ceiling Windows

One Laguna's open spaces maximize the visual connection with the surroundings. Floor-to-ceiling windows eliminate the barrier between inside and outside, allowing the lagoon, sky, and vegetation to become part of the design. The façade waves designed by HKS frame these views like moving paintings — a naturally changing landscape that never goes out of style.

Artificial Lighting That Complements

The architectural lighting, specified by ROAM, was designed to complement, never compete with, natural light. Warm temperatures (2700K-3000K) that replicate sunset light, positioned to create depth and atmosphere without artificial drama.


Proportions the Eye Never Questions

The Geometry of Comfort

HKS Architects applied classic proportions throughout every space at One Laguna. Generous ceiling heights that allow you to breathe. Width-to-length ratios that create a sense of spaciousness without feeling empty. Smooth transitions between public and private spaces within each residence — a fluidity that reflects the same façade waves translated to domestic scale.

These proportions aren't arbitrary — they're the result of decades of research into the geometry of wellbeing. Well-proportioned spaces reduce anxiety, improve rest, and increase the sense of calm.

Functional Minimalism, Not Aesthetic

Minimalism at One Laguna isn't an aesthetic pose — it's distilled functionality. Every element has a purpose. Storage spaces are integrated, installations are invisible, and lines are clean because complexity was resolved before the resident arrived.
